- Lock Picking: Experience in the art of opening mechanical locks without keys. Locks sophisticated enough to have a machine spirit likely requires a Tech (Security) to convince them to open.
- Pickpocket: Competence in pilfering the contents of others’ pockets, bags, backpacks, etc. without their noticing. Can also be used in reverse to place (incriminating) items within. Pickpocket is usually opposed by Awareness (Touch).
- Sleight of Hand: Training in performing tricks of prestidigitation and secreting various items even while being observed. A master can conceal a weapon with the Subtle Trait even while being searched. Sleight of Hand is usually opposed by Awareness (Sight).
- Defuse (Restricted): Practical rote instruction in the various techniques and prayers used to harmlessly deactivate explosive devices and disarm trap mechanisms. Defuse requires at least 1 Advance in the Tech Skill.
Dexterity is a measure of a character’s ability to perform delicate, fine motor function. This includes working with small tools and precise manipulations. The skill is vital for performing maintenance works on most technological devices, but some master the art for more nefarious purposes such as deception and thievery. The key connection between these distinct tasks is the ability to carefully and quickly make delicate small motions in a refined way.
